Carmichael child in front of Carmichael Buildings along Dixie Highway (Route 3) between Smyrna and Chattahoochee. Left to right: Carmichael cotton gin, well house, available to travelers who stayed overnight in wagon yard, blacksmith shop on Carmichael farm for public, barn, Carmichael's Crossing streetcar stop, behind the streetcar stop was Carmichael store. Wagon yard. Dixie Highway (Route 3), between Smyrna and Chattahoochee. Families from north could stop overnight at Carmichael farm on their trips into Atlanta for provisions (usually in spring and fall)."--from field notes</dc:description><dc:format>image/jpeg</dc:format><dc:rights>http://rightsstatements.org/vocab/NoC-CR/1.0/</dc:rights><dc:subject>Children--Georgia--Cobb County</dc:subject><dc:subject>Women--Georgia--Cobb County</dc:subject><dc:subject>Agriculture--Georgia--Cobb County</dc:subject><dc:subject>Domestic life--Georgia--Cobb County</dc:subject><dc:subject>Portraits--Georgia--Cobb County</dc:subject><dc:title>[Photograph of Carmichael child in front of Carmichael Buildings, Cobb County, Georgia, ca. 1907]</dc:title><dc:type>StillImage</dc:type></oai_dc:dc>
